It was 1974 in Budapest, Hungary, when a young architecture professor named Ernő Rubik set out to solve a structural problem. He wanted a way to model three-dimensional movement for his students, something that could allow independent parts to move without the entire mechanism falling apart. What he ended up creating—after weeks of tinkering with wood, rubber bands, and paperclips—was the first working prototype of the "Magic Cube" (Bűvös Kocka).
Legend has it that Rubik himself didn't know if the puzzle could actually be solved once he scrambled it. It took him over a month of intense logic and mathematics to return his invention to its original state. Little did he know that his classroom tool would soon become the world’s most popular toy.
The puzzle was rebranded as the "Rubik’s Cube" and launched internationally in 1980 by the Ideal Toy Corp. The craze was immediate and overwhelming. It wasn't just a toy; it was a cultural icon of the 80s. From schoolyards to high-stakes competitions, everyone was trying to master the 43 quintillion possible permutations.
By 1982, more than 100 million cubes had been sold worldwide. However, the initial design was stiff and prone to jamming—a far cry from the high-performance hardware we use today. Early cubers had to use petroleum jelly or silicone sprays just to make the layers turn smoothly.
As the initial fad cooled down in the late 80s, a dedicated underground community kept the spirit alive. They developed advanced algorithms like the Fridrich Method (CFOP), which drastically reduced solve times. This demand for speed led to a revolution in hardware. Manufacturers began experimenting with internal rounded corners, adjustable tensions, and eventually, the introduction of magnets to stabilize turns.

In the last decade, the Rubik's Cube has entered the digital age. We have moved beyond simple mechanical puzzles to "Smart Cubes" that connect via Bluetooth to your smartphone. These devices track your turns in real-time, offer personalized coaching, and allow you to race against cubers across the globe instantly.
